Résumé

Science and engineering research must be communicated within the research community and to the general public, and a crucial element of that communication is visual. In Envisioning Science, science photographer Felice Frankel provides a guide to creating dynamic and compelling photographs for journal submissions and for scientific presentations to funding agencies, investors, and the general public. The book is organized from the large to the small, from pictures of new material and biological structures made with a camera and lens, to images made with a stereomicroscope, compound microscope, and scanning electron microscope (SEM). The text explains how to design, craft, and execute effective images, SEMs, and diagrams while maintaining scientific integrity. Full-color illustrations, including many instructional side-by-side comparisons, provide examples from the physical and biological sciences, biotechnology, nanotechnology, electrical engineering, materials science, and mechanical engineering to encourage a new way to see and create images of science. After a brief historical overview by science educator Phylis Morrison, Frankel discusses technical issues and, just as important, her personal approach to creating images that are both scientifically informational and accessible. This is a handbook that should become a standard tool in all research laboratories.

Biographie de Felice Frankel

Felice Frankel is Research Scientist at the Massachusetts Institute of Technology. She is coauthor with George M. Whitesides of On the Surface of Things: Images of the Extraordinary in Science. Her photographs, taken in collaboration with researchers, have appeared on the covers and pages of numerous publications, including Nature, Science, Journal of Physical Chemistry, and Cellular Biology. She has been awarded a Guggenheim Fellowship and a Loeb Fellowship at Harvard University and has received grants from the National Science Foundation, the Alfred P. Sloan Foundation, the Camille and Henry Dreyfus Foundation, the National Endowment for the Arts, and the Graham Foundation for Advanced Studies in the Fine Arts. She is a Fellow of the American Association for the Advancement of Science.
